A Tale of Two Experiences: Notary and Member Services

The core of the divergent feedback for this AAA location lies in its member services, specifically those related to notary and vehicle title transfers. On one hand, there is strong positive testimony for the staff's conduct in sensitive situations. One customer, Luella Curtis, praised an employee named Scott for being exceptionally kind and helpful while handling title paperwork following the passing of her husband. This highlights a capacity for empathetic and effective service, suggesting that for certain standard procedures, the staff is more than capable and supportive.

However, a significant number of reviews paint a starkly different picture, citing issues of incompetence with more complex or non-standard transactions. Multiple customers expressed extreme disappointment when attempting to register vehicles or transfer out-of-state titles. One long-time AAA member described the staff as "completely clueless" when trying to register a new lightweight recreational trailer, claiming they provided incorrect and costly advice that would have led to an unnecessary "enhanced inspection." Another user was turned away twice for a title transfer due to shifting paperwork requirements. In both cases, the customers reported leaving the AAA office and successfully completing their transactions at a nearby private notary in under 15 minutes. This pattern suggests a potential knowledge gap among the staff for anything outside of routine Pennsylvania-based vehicle paperwork, a critical point for clients with unique registration needs to consider.

Evaluating the Insurance Offerings

As an insurance agency, AAA Meadville provides a range of products, but here too, the customer experience is not universally positive. One detailed account from a client, David Colvin, reported a sudden and steep 32% increase in his rental insurance policies. His frustration was compounded by a difficult customer service experience, which involved nearly three hours on the phone and multiple callbacks, only to feel dismissed when questioning inaccuracies in his policy details, such as his home's construction date and style. He ultimately found policies from competing insurers that were more than 30% cheaper. This experience serves as a crucial reminder for potential insurance clients to diligently compare quotes and meticulously review all policy documents for accuracy before committing.
